Received: by 2002:a05:6a10:5bc5:0:0:0:0 with SMTP id os5csp2835401pxb; Mon, 1 Nov 2021 02:51:45 -0700 (PDT) X-Google-Smtp-Source: ABdhPJwJK6qltwoXW1+sLT6msOm4ZeOYLGECVt301MuxpNHtFc0SLRUeTIsLLRPvuCBsFeHvG8EF X-Received: by 2002:a05:6402:3488:: with SMTP id v8mr14047365edc.170.1635760305526; Mon, 01 Nov 2021 02:51:45 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1635760305; cv=none; d=google.com; s=arc-20160816; b=AqwBgRuJX4PQBBGs0x+pe8RGcswcxoUCM3dV0kjTJo52sORz5huGeiYFHJc3o7xhLf dXBiRaS/CAhGWpUStCTbSMT8wVd8M5ixKwCVDQBAzEEfKRX4vnQd3wPl+HNyzGdVCFHw FFJs06Q6LR7YUdACe4aYx//EDZi4V19eklDM6nSgsclbzpDnA+7g6QHDDHuETnwolMBv FGuUq+VBGrWlNdLAKAWR43BdD2TCbxQhdYN5LALewZsy8R/ffhSeipoXAXZ/Qrbw/ppi Xv8ks9MaQv1rqvktAyK7LO6+5vJeOdPHz5iWJ2QRmKJbFBcnMOpZ8n4dKU8nAPtnY2YK AgvA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:mime-version :user-agent:references:in-reply-to:message-id:date:subject:cc:to :from:dkim-signature; bh=aelOn6pLYAlg7H0k5bfTQzx7bO63uUVGSeg1xMh358M=; b=Rpx+EScN2jIrwY+m8ImBQ1xl13Pia4prY6tyxW1fslgEH0Pbd1OBwmn0RUptR5RSVr MxJDaKdZSdTYN0AbebLUNj41DU/NDtBNhL3HwULxtoMpLjWGpMNH7DfGRRM14f91vw6W wwgZThzSVqurZwb43PzrYiITJ6XtGFbLI0dE23jTnd5KiPTxUANzaqNMJrGzL22zipjl 7lRCHdkCuVXjxJxVIHiR7r49y12c4+L2Ag4k6ypbD1Ky63MZhQbWqH++xGlL4bkUPTJ4 zoqpYilqJ1SX3bVPQGSPsn+KpfRgPhb49M6ifEOb4j6VuQe5AjPrOliRtowScPSrJlt1 nMQA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linuxfoundation.org header.s=korg header.b=pIuhWbby;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linuxfoundation.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id d14si7006206edr.634.2021.11.01.02.51.21; Mon, 01 Nov 2021 02:51:45 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@linuxfoundation.org header.s=korg header.b=pIuhWbby;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linuxfoundation.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S233895AbhKAJwF (ORCPT + 99 others); Mon, 1 Nov 2021 05:52:05 -0400 Received: from mail.kernel.org ([198.145.29.99]:51108 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S233144AbhKAJpA (ORCPT ); Mon, 1 Nov 2021 05:45:00 -0400 Received: by mail.kernel.org (Postfix) with ESMTPSA id C267760C41; Mon, 1 Nov 2021 09:29:55 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=linuxfoundation.org; s=korg; t=1635758996; bh=s/GCZQS4eKhH9G78N4AHMdG9j9LpI4/y02eoL8pkNBE=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=pIuhWbbycc/D0zNjqQhmnJ2xdrx2TSVe+NI6ctwynR1nRXUpVGnxhP/QFg+pg1UHY 8GMco8X4ieB6X/TxRUK9tsB3ppYFMcP62MlKGtXcBUnHOjTGjnVCAtrh4QhU1mX2u+ FisD3SSOwqWifVlVh09lk+WdQJ53d2fHYP3pyQg4= From: Greg Kroah-Hartman To: linux-kernel@vger.kernel.org Cc: Greg Kroah-Hartman , stable@vger.kernel.org, Frieder Schrempf , Shawn Guo Subject: [PATCH 5.14 038/125] arm64: dts: imx8mm-kontron: Fix CAN SPI clock frequency Date: Mon, 1 Nov 2021 10:16:51 +0100 Message-Id: <20211101082540.377488703@linuxfoundation.org> X-Mailer: git-send-email 2.33.1 In-Reply-To: <20211101082533.618411490@linuxfoundation.org> References: <20211101082533.618411490@linuxfoundation.org> User-Agent: quilt/0.66 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Frieder Schrempf commit ca6f9d85d5944046a241b325700c1ca395651c28 upstream. The MCP2515 can be used with an SPI clock of up to 10 MHz. Set the limit accordingly to prevent any performance issues caused by the really low clock speed of 100 kHz. This removes the arbitrarily low limit on the SPI frequency, that was caused by a typo in the original dts. Without this change, receiving CAN messages on the board beyond a certain bitrate will cause overrun errors (see 'ip -det -stat link show can0'). With this fix, receiving messages on the bus works without any overrun errors for bitrates up to 1 MBit. Fixes: 8668d8b2e67f ("arm64: dts: Add the Kontron i.MX8M Mini SoMs and baseboards") Cc: stable@vger.kernel.org Signed-off-by: Frieder Schrempf Signed-off-by: Shawn Guo Signed-off-by: Greg Kroah-Hartman --- arch/arm64/boot/dts/freescale/imx8mm-kontron-n801x-s.dts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) --- a/arch/arm64/boot/dts/freescale/imx8mm-kontron-n801x-s.dts +++ b/arch/arm64/boot/dts/freescale/imx8mm-kontron-n801x-s.dts @@ -97,7 +97,7 @@ clocks = <&osc_can>; interrupt-parent = <&gpio4>; interrupts = <28 IRQ_TYPE_EDGE_FALLING>; - spi-max-frequency = <100000>; + spi-max-frequency = <10000000>; vdd-supply = <®_vdd_3v3>; xceiver-supply = <®_vdd_5v>; };